About the position:
Pacific Aviation is looking for Aircraft Dispatchers to join our Los Angeles International Airport (LAX) flight operations team.
Core Responsibilities:
Flight Operations
- Responsible for the safety and execution of assigned flights.
- Preparation and file computerized Flight and ATC plans for International; Trans-Pacific/ Atlantic Flights.
- Provide full weather/ operational briefing to flight crews analyze weather NOTAMS and ATC data to ensure safe operations and compliance with Airline SOPs
Teamwork
- Collaborate and partner with fellow dispatchers to ensure uninterrupted service for flight operations and to foster a positive work environment where all team members feel appreciated.
Administration
- Complete submit and deliver all assigned reports in a time manner to ensure flights take off in on schedule.
- Ensure compliance with airport regulations and airline requirements
Requirements
- Mandatory requirement : FAA Flight Dispatch License
- Must possess knowledge of flight planning software such as SITA/ARI NC/LIDO/JEPPESEN/SABER
- Must be able to complete airline specific training
- Must possess several years of experience conducting flight operations or utilizing flight operations systems in a similar capacity (such as being a pilot)
